This tutorial demonstrates how to scan a document into a PDF file using a Google Pixel 7A. Firstly, locate and open the Google Drive app, which should be pre-installed on your phone. If not, download it for free from the Google Play Store. Once in the Drive app, tap the plus icon and select the scan option. Grant camera access to the app and decide on location access. Take a picture of the document you want to scan, then adjust it as needed - rotate, change color scheme, frame, etc. If satisfied, proceed; if not, retake the photo.

While you can find many PDF editors in the Google Play store, Google doesnt have its own PDF editing software that you can download. There is, however, a built-in PDF viewer on Chrome. With that viewer, you can annotate, highlight, draw on, sign, and fill PDFs.

You can fill out PDF forms in Google Drive on your Android device. On your Android device, open the Google Drive app. Tap the PDF that you want to fill out. At the bottom right, tap Edit. Form Filling . Enter your information in the PDF form. At the top right, tap Save. To save as a copy, click More.
Using an iframe tag is the second way to embed a pdf file in an HTML web page. In web development, web developers use the iframe tag to embed files in various formats and even other websites within a web page. Due to its wide compatibility, the iframe tag is widely used for embedding pdf.
